Some time back a really irritating problem appeared which I have never been able to get to the bottom of. It would be great if one of you kind people could throw some light on it. When I load a (recorded) CD into the drive, the Internet Explorer logo superimposes itself over each of the files displayed, irrespective of the "View" I select. I realize the drive is quite old now - about 4yrs - but it has always produced good results for what I need and it would be nice to rectify this problem if possible. It would suggest that the contents of the CD is .jpg images and if so simply either change your default program for viewing .jpg files or simply change the icon associated with .jpg files.
Go to Control Panel, Appearance and Themes (if in Category view) or Folder options (if in Classic view) and then go to the View tab to find .jpg. Make your adjustments there.
